BROKER–DEALERS (Fewer Than 1,000 Advisors) - Corporate Social Responsibility/Diversity

WINNER - SPS4Vets

SPS4Vets is an initiative to help veterans in the community with their fiscal fitness. Advisors within the Sigma Financial Corporation (Sigma) back office work with local veterans, pro bono, to discuss their financial needs and help them gain clarity on their financial future...

FINALIST - Mid-Atlantic Chapter of Women’s Interactive Network (WIN) Employee Resource Group

In 2012, Janney’s Women’s Interactive Network (WIN) Employee Resource Group (ERG) was created to improve the business and professional environment for all with an emphasis on the advancement, retention, and recruitment of women. After successful growth of this ERG in the home office, the Mid Atlantic Chapter (MAC WIN) was created in 2019 to encourage corporate engagement and community activities at a local level with our regional offices...
